2. What Is a Ridge Ventilator?
A ridge ventilator is a ventilation device installed along the top ridge of industrial or commercial roofs. It allows hot air to escape while keeping out rain and dust.
This creates a consistent airflow cycle:
- Hot air rises and exits through the ridge ventilator
- Fresh air enters through louvers, doors, and side openings
- The building stays cooler without fans or electricity
3. How Ridge Ventilators Work
Ridge ventilators operate on the principle of natural convection. Hot air is lighter, so it rises and escapes through the ridge opening. Meanwhile, cool air enters from lower points, creating continuous air circulation.
– No mechanical components are involved.
– It does not require any power.
– No maintenance is necessary.
4. Types of Ridge Ventilators
✅ 1. Static Ridge Ventilator
- Fixed design
- Zero moving parts
- Most durable option
- Common in factories & warehouses
✅ 2. Turbo Ridge Ventilator (Hybrid)
- Includes a turbo fan on top of the ridge
- Uses wind energy to speed up air removal
- Ideal for high-heat industries
✅ 3. Continuous Ridge Ventilator
- Installed across the entire roof length
- Offers maximum airflow
- Suitable for large industrial buildings

6. Technical Specifications (Recommended for Industry)
| Specification | Recommended Range |
|---|---|
| Material | PPGL (AZ150) / PPGI (Z275) |
| Coating | 18–25 Microns |
| Length | 2 ft – 10 ft modules |
| Throat Size | 24″ / 32″ / 36″ |
| Airflow Rate | 300–1200 CFM (depends on size) |
| Accessories | Bird mesh, rainproof cowl |

8. How to Choose the Right Ridge Ventilator
Consider:
- Shed height
- Machinery heat load
- Local climate
- Roof pitch & length
- Required airflow volume
- Budget
- Material (prefer AZ150 PPGL for long life)
9. Installation Guidelines
- Install along the highest ridge line
- Ensure airtight sealing on edges
- Maintain a uniform gap for airflow
- Use SS or galvanized fasteners
- If necessary, add bird mesh.
- Keep your projects on track by steering clear of installation during the rainy season!
- Follow the manufacturer’s alignment markings
Improper installation may cause leakage issues.

11. Pricing Factors
Pricing depends on:
- Length and throat size
- Material thickness
- Coating grade (AZ70 / AZ150 / AZ200)
- Accessories (bird mesh, dampers)
- Quantity
- Installation complexity
PPGL ridge ventilators offer the best lifespan in industrial conditions.
